Jasmine Lennard
Jasmine Lennard was born on 26 July 1985.
Her parents were Marilyn Galsworthy, who acted in The Spy Who Loved Me, and Brian Lennard, founder of Sacha shoes.

Jasmine did not win Make Me A Supermodel when she was a contestant. That honour went to Alice Sinclair.
In October 2006, Jasmine Lennard was fired from presenting Make Me a Supermodel Extra for insulting judge Rachel Hunter, whom she described as "spotty, finished and fat".
In a where are they now documentary about Make Me A Supermodel, Jasmine Lennard is portrayed as a 'rich bitch', and she refuses to attend the final group photoshoot.
Jasmine Lennard was shown working in Ayia Napa in the TV series, 'Trust Me, I'm A Holiday Rep'. She was also on The Weakest Link but was voted off early on.
